About 12 Apple Way

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

12 Apple Way is a mid-terrace house in Middleton, Manchester, Manchester (M24 1GX). It has a recorded floor area of 41 m² (around 441 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1991-1995 and council tax band A. At 41 m² this is the smallest unit on EPC record across the building (41–121 m²). The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the top. The latest certificate (March 2021) shows a C (score 76), near the top of the C band.

It hasn't traded since September 2003, a hold of 23 years that's notably long for the area. Across 1995–2003, sale prices on this property compounded at 11.3%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£119,000 sits 105.3% above the 2003 sale of £57,950. At 41 m² it sits well below the postcode median (74 m² across 11 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ally.
